Material Costs - The cost for roofing materials varies depending on the type selected, such as asphalt shingles, metal, or tile. Typically, material expenses range from $1,500 to $6,000 for an average-sized barn roof. Prices can fluctuate based on quality and supplier choices.
Labor Expenses - Labor costs for barn roof replacement generally fall between $1,000 and $4,500. These rates depend on roof size, complexity, and local contractor rates in Orland Park, IL and nearby areas.
Additional Fees - Extra charges may include permits, debris removal, and structural repairs, which can add $300 to $2,000 to the overall cost. These fees vary depending on the project's scope and local regulations.
Total Project Cost - Combining materials, labor, and additional fees, the total cost for barn roof replacement typically ranges from $3,000 to $12,500. Exact prices depend on specific project details and chosen materials.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How often should barn roofs be replaced? The lifespan of a barn roof varies depending on materials and maintenance, but generally, it is recommended to consider replacement when signs of significant wear, leaks, or damage appear.
What types of roofing materials are suitable for barn roof replacement? Common options include metal, asphalt shingles, wood shakes, and rubber roofing, with the choice depending on durability, budget, and aesthetic preferences.
What are the signs that indicate a barn roof needs replacement? Indicators include persistent leaks, missing or damaged shingles, visible sagging, rust or corrosion, and extensive wear or aging of roofing materials.
How long does a barn roof replacement typically take? The duration varies based on the size of the barn and the roofing material used, but most replacements can be completed within a few days.
